I would have to check out the schematic wiring to let you know if that door switch does something other than just break the loop to your gas valve. those sensors you speak of are they about the size of a dime with a two hole bracket? if this is so they are a bi-metallic switch that serves as a limit switch temperature controlled. as they heat up they open -or- close depending on usage.
